Prices are still going up on the Caribbean island of Barbados, despite the market conditions, property company Cluttons Barbados claims. Valuations are appreciating 10 to 15 percent a year and “often higher in the luxury end,” the property firm says “In the recorded history of property on the island, property values have never declined,” Cluttons [...]
